S&P 500
It stands for Standard & Poor 500 and it includes 500 leading US companies. The index
stands for over $ 7.8 trillion and approximately 2.2 billion stocks, which is about 80
percent of available market capitalization.
FTSE 100
It stands for Financial Times Stock Exchange. It represents 80% of the market
capitalization of the London Stocks Exchange. The FTSE is a share index which shows how
British economy is performing.

The EURO STOXX 50
It represents the 50 largest companies in Europe. It covers stocks from 11 EU member
states: Austria, Belgium, Ireland, Italy, the Netherlands, Luxembourg, Spain, Portugal,
Finland, France and Germany.

Technical and Fundamental Analysis
Trading analysis is a critical part of your trading experience and can help you identify
events, trends and show you which one could impact your trading. Technical analysis
relies on charts, trends and prediction of the price direction based on the past
behaviour. Fundamental analysis is based on the bigger picture, how financial events and
news can impact future prices. Fundamentals look at economic data, political events,
factors influencing supply and demand.
